// Copyright (c) 2011-2021 The Bitcoin Core developers
// Copyright (c) 2014-2025 The Dash Core developers
// Distributed under the MIT software license, see the accompanying
// file COPYING or http://www.opensource.org/licenses/mit-license.php.
#ifndef BITCOIN_QT_CLIENTMODEL_H
#define BITCOIN_QT_CLIENTMODEL_H
#include <interfaces/node.h>
#include <netaddress.h>
#include <sync.h>
#include <uint256.h>
#include <QObject>
#include <QDateTime>
#include <atomic>
#include <memory>
class BanTableModel;
class ChainLockFeed;
class ClientFeeds;
class CreditPoolFeed;
class InstantSendFeed;
class MasternodeFeed;
class OptionsModel;
class QuorumFeed;
class PeerTableModel;
class PeerTableSortProxy;
class ProposalFeed;
enum class SynchronizationState;
struct LocalServiceInfo;
namespace interfaces {
struct BlockTip;
} // namespace interfaces
enum class BlockSource {
NONE,
DISK,
NETWORK,
};
enum NumConnections {
CONNECTIONS_NONE = 0,
CONNECTIONS_IN = (1U << 0),
CONNECTIONS_OUT = (1U << 1),
CONNECTIONS_ALL = (CONNECTIONS_IN | CONNECTIONS_OUT),
};
class CGovernanceObject;
/** Model for Dash network client. */
class ClientModel : public QObject
{
Q_OBJECT
public:
explicit ClientModel(interfaces::Node& node, OptionsModel *optionsModel, QObject *parent = nullptr);
~ClientModel();
void stop();
interfaces::Node& node() const { return m_node; }
interfaces::Masternode::Sync& masternodeSync() const { return m_node.masternodeSync(); }
interfaces::CoinJoin::Options& coinJoinOptions() const { return m_node.coinJoinOptions(); }
OptionsModel *getOptionsModel();
PeerTableModel *getPeerTableModel();
PeerTableSortProxy* peerTableSortProxy();
BanTableModel *getBanTableModel();
ChainLockFeed* feedChainLock() const { return m_feed_chainlock; }
CreditPoolFeed* feedCreditPool() const { return m_feed_creditpool; }
InstantSendFeed* feedInstantSend() const { return m_feed_instantsend; }
MasternodeFeed* feedMasternode() const { return m_feed_masternode; }
ProposalFeed* feedProposal() const { return m_feed_proposal; }
QuorumFeed* feedQuorum() const { return m_feed_quorum; }
//! Return number of connections, default is in- and outbound (total)
int getNumConnections(unsigned int flags = CONNECTIONS_ALL) const;
std::map<CNetAddr, LocalServiceInfo> getNetLocalAddresses() const;
int getNumBlocks() const;
uint256 getBestBlockHash() EXCLUSIVE_LOCKS_REQUIRED(!m_cached_tip_mutex);
int getHeaderTipHeight() const;
int64_t getHeaderTipTime() const;
void getAllGovernanceObjects(std::vector<CGovernanceObject> &obj);
//! Returns the block source of the current importing/syncing state
BlockSource getBlockSource() const;
//! Return warnings to be displayed in status bar
QString getStatusBarWarnings() const;
QString formatFullVersion() const;
QString formatSubVersion() const;
bool isReleaseVersion() const;
QString formatClientStartupTime() const;
QString dataDir() const;
QString blocksDir() const;
bool getProxyInfo(std::string& ip_port) const;
// caches for the best header: hash, number of blocks and block time
mutable std::atomic<int> cachedBestHeaderHeight;
mutable std::atomic<int64_t> cachedBestHeaderTime;
mutable std::atomic<int> m_cached_num_blocks{-1};
Mutex m_cached_tip_mutex;
uint256 m_cached_tip_blocks GUARDED_BY(m_cached_tip_mutex){};
private:
interfaces::Node& m_node;
std::vector<std::unique_ptr<interfaces::Handler>> m_event_handlers;
OptionsModel *optionsModel;
PeerTableModel* peerTableModel{nullptr};
PeerTableSortProxy* m_peer_table_sort_proxy{nullptr};
BanTableModel* banTableModel{nullptr};
//! A thread to interact with m_node asynchronously
QThread* const m_thread;
//! Data sources from different subsystems coordinated by model
ChainLockFeed* m_feed_chainlock{nullptr};
CreditPoolFeed* m_feed_creditpool{nullptr};
InstantSendFeed* m_feed_instantsend{nullptr};
MasternodeFeed* m_feed_masternode{nullptr};
ProposalFeed* m_feed_proposal{nullptr};
QuorumFeed* m_feed_quorum{nullptr};
std::unique_ptr<ClientFeeds> m_feeds{nullptr};
void TipChanged(SynchronizationState sync_state, interfaces::BlockTip tip, double verification_progress, bool header) EXCLUSIVE_LOCKS_REQUIRED(!m_cached_tip_mutex);
void subscribeToCoreSignals();
void unsubscribeFromCoreSignals();
Q_SIGNALS:
void numConnectionsChanged(int count);
void governanceChanged();
void masternodeListChanged() const;
void chainLockChanged();
void numBlocksChanged(int count, const QDateTime& blockDate, const QString& blockHash, double nVerificationProgress, bool header, SynchronizationState sync_state);
void additionalDataSyncProgressChanged(double nSyncProgress);
void mempoolSizeChanged(long count, size_t mempoolSizeInBytes, size_t mempoolMaxSizeInBytes);
void instantSendChanged();
void networkActiveChanged(bool networkActive);
void alertsChanged(const QString &warnings);
//! Fired when a message should be reported to the user
void message(const QString &title, const QString &message, unsigned int style);
// Show progress dialog e.g. for verifychain
void showProgress(const QString &title, int nProgress);
};
#endif // BITCOIN_QT_CLIENTMODEL_H
